Cureton confirmed on Shrews' radar

12 February 2010 13:49
The 34-year-old, who re-joined the Canaries in 2007 following spells at Bristol Rovers, Reading and QPR, has only featured eight times for the League One side during the current campaign.[LNB]Norwich boss Paul Lambert revealed earlier in the week that there were a number of players, namely former Shrew Grant Holt, Chris Martin, Oli Johnson and Cody McDonald, ahead of the veteran frontman in the pecking order at Carrow Road.[LNB]Simpson told BBC Radio Shropshire: "Cureton is a player I've spoken to, but I haven't had a yes or no - but that also goes for a number of others.[LNB]"I'm looking for someone with a track record of scoring goals, but at the moment I'm hitting a brick wall."[LNB][LNB]
